package jadex.bdi.examples.booktrading.buyer;
import jadex.bdi.planlib.protocols.ParticipantProposal;
import jadex.bdi.runtime.Plan;
import java.util.ArrayList;
import java.util.Collections;
import java.util.Comparator;
import java.util.List;
/**
* Evaluate the received proposals.
*/
public class EvaluateProposalsPlan extends Plan
{
/**
* The plan body.
*/
public void body()
{
// System.out.println("Determine acceptables");
// Get order properties and calculate acceptable price.
int acceptable_price = ((Integer)getParameter("cfp_info").getValue()).intValue();
// ParticipantProposal[] proposals = (ParticipantProposal[])getParameterSet("proposals").getValues();
Object[] proposals = (Object[])getParameterSet("proposals").getValues();
// Determine acceptables
List accs = new ArrayList();
for(int i=0; i<proposals.length; i++)
{
if(((Integer)((ParticipantProposal)proposals[i]).getProposal()).intValue() <= acceptable_price)
accs.add(proposals[i]);
}
// Sort acceptables by price.
if(accs.size()>1)
{
Collections.sort(accs, new Comparator()
{
public int compare(Object arg0, Object arg1) {
return ((Comparable) ((ParticipantProposal)arg0).getProposal())
.compareTo(((ParticipantProposal)arg1).getProposal());
}
});
}
if(accs.size()>0)
{
// System.out.println("Acceptable offer found: "+accs.get(0));
getParameterSet("acceptables").addValue(accs.get(0));
}
else
{
// System.out.println("No acceptable offer found: "+accs);
}
}
}
